Зміст
Однією з проблем Unix-заснованих операційних систем (як настільних, так і мобільних) є коректне декодування Мультимедіа. На Android ця процедура ускладнюється ще й колосальним різноманітністю процесорів і підтримуваних ними інструкцій. З цією проблемою розробники справляються, випускаючи окремі компоненти-кодеки для своїх програвачів.
MX Player кодек (ARMv7)
Специфічний кодек з ряду причин. Типологія ARMv7 на сьогодні являє собою передостаннє покоління процесорів, проте всередині Процесори такої архітектури розрізняються по ряду ознак – наприклад, набору інструкцій і типу ядер. Від цього і залежить вибір кодека для програвача.
Власне, зазначений кодек призначений в першу чергу для пристроїв з процесором NVIDIA Tegra 2 (наприклад, смартфонів Motorola Atrix 4G або планшета Samsung GT-P7500 Galaxy Tab 10.1). Цей процесор відомий своїми проблемами відтворення HD-відео, і вказаний кодек для MX Player допоможе їх вирішити. Природно, знадобиться встановити сам MX Player з Google Play Маркета . У рідкісних випадках кодек може бути несумісний з пристроєм, так що майте цей нюанс на увазі.
Завантажити MX Player кодек (ARMv7)
MX Player кодек (ARMv7 NEON)
По суті, містить в собі вищевказане ПО для декодування відео плюс компоненти, які підтримують інструкції NEON, більш продуктивні і енергоефективні. Як правило, для пристроїв з підтримкою NEON установка додаткових кодеків не потрібно.
Версії Емікс плеєра, які встановлені не з Google Play Маркета, часто не володіють таким функціоналом – в цьому випадку компоненти доводиться качати і встановлювати окремо. Деякі пристрої на рідкісних процесорах (наприклад, Broadcom або TI OMAP) вимагають ручного встановлення кодеків. Але повторимося-для більшості пристроїв цього не потрібно.
Завантажити MX Player кодек (ARMv7 NEON)
MX Player кодек (x86)
Більшість сучасних мобільних девайсів виготовлені на базі процесорів з архітектурою ARM, проте деякі виробники експериментують з переважно настільною архітектурою x86. Єдиним виробником таких процесорів є компанія Intel, чиї продукти довгий час встановлювалися в смартфони і планшети ASUS.
Відповідно, цей кодек і призначений в основному для таких пристроїв. Не вдаючись у подробиці, відзначимо, що робота Android на таких ЦП дуже специфічна, і користувач буде змушений встановити відповідний компонент програвача, щоб той зміг коректно відтворювати відеоролики. Іноді може знадобитися ручна настройка кодека, але це вже тема для окремої статті.
Завантажити MX Player кодек (x86)
DDB2 Codec Pack
На відміну від вищеописаних, цей набір інструкцій кодування і декодування призначений для аудіоплеєра DDB2 і включає в себе компоненти для роботи з такими форматами, як APE, ALAC і ряду малопоширених звукових форматів, в тому числі і мережевого мовлення.
Відрізняється цей пак кодеків і причинами своєї відсутності в основному додатку – їх немає в ДДБ2 заради задоволення вимог ліцензії GPL, по якій і поширюються додатки в Google Play Маркеті. Однак відтворення деяких важких форматів навіть при наявності цього компонента все одно не гарантується.
AC3 Codec
І плеєр, і кодек, здатні програвати аудіофайли і звукові доріжки фільмів у форматі AC3. Сам додаток може функціонувати як програвач відео, причому завдяки йде в комплекті декодують компонентів відрізняється «всеїдністю» форматів.
Як відеоплеєр додаток являє собою рішення з розряду «нічого зайвого», і може бути цікавим тільки як заміна зазвичай малофункціональним стоковим програвачів. Як правило, з більшістю пристроїв працює коректно, проте на деяких девайсах можуть спостерігатися проблеми – в першу чергу це стосується машинок на специфічних процесорах. Відсутня в Плей Маркеті, доступно на сторонніх сервісах.
Android у багато відрізняється від Windows в плані роботи з мультимедіа &8212; більшість форматів буде читатися, як то кажуть, &171;з коробки&187;. Необхідність в кодеках з'являється тільки в разі нестандартного &171;заліза&187; або версії програвача.